Hello! This week I am coming to you with a process video1 that will hopefully bring you a bit of inspiration, a peek at me facing a fear, as well as some lovely Cambridge river vibes!

I wrote in a recent post about ambitions that I brought back with me from holiday. And a big scary one is making original art to sell!

It feels like a big grown-up thing to do, and I feel very intimidated by the idea. But in the past, I know that I tend to underestimate my ability to do things, and I have learned to just do them anyway, and push past my fear. The results are normally much less disastrous than I invented in my head! A friend said to me recently when I was debating whether to enter a prize that if I don’t enter, I am saying no to myself. Let them say no she said. So wise!

the framed artwork.
the full piece

So for my process video this month, rather than just filming myself painting in a sketchbook, as I normally would; when I packed my things, I packed some nice paper, instead of a sketchbook, and made a piece of original art! And actually, it wasn’t as intimidating as I feared. I made a piece that I enjoyed making - this is a really important ingredient to making a successful piece of art for me - and I was pleased with the results too; AND I tried something I was scared to do. Triple win!

I take you through the whole thing in the video, and I talk more in depth about it all.
